FT63 OPD is a 2013 Honda Civic in White with a 1,798c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 92.3%.
Across all 2013 Honda Civic models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.3% with a typical mileage of 61,107 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Honda Civic f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 307,913 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FT63 OPD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Civic typ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 13 years old, this Honda Civic is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
